I have 3 domains that I would like to have share a single directory.

This single directory will contain product images that all 3 sites have in common.

I have created symbolic links in 2 of the sites that point to the directory of the third site.

When attempting to access files in the shared folder from either of the 2 sites I receive an invalid permissions message.

The shared folder has been chmod -R 777 * on it so the only thing that I can think of is perhaps the open_basedir setting is getting in my way.

Does anyone have any thoughts on how I can get this to work and what needs to be done?
